Details:
I made a collage using two images taken respectively at the beginning and at the ending of the occultation. Brightness and color balance are different between the two images because at the ending of the occultation the Sun was rising. Two distinct processings were done for the Moon and Saturn, then they were joined together using as reference a frame where both the Moon and Saturn were visible (with an intermediate exposure between the one required by Saturn and by the Moon). The time of the shot is: 2024 August 21, UT 03:31 (left image) and 04:33 (right image). Location: Marina di Massa (Tuscany, Italy), home garden. Equipment: - Celestron Nexstar 127slt maksutov telescope - Zwo ADC - Zwo Asi 120mc-s color camera. Processing: - PIPP (debayer) - Autostakkert (stacking) - Registax (sharpening) - Adobe Photoshop.
